INTERIORS: THE WILLIAM VALE

by gregory davalos


I've spent the better half of the year racking up frequent flier miles and staying at countless hotels around the world. My travels have taught me countless lessons and unearthed a multitude of hidden talents, one of them being photographing interiors. 

On my most recent trip to New York I was lucky enough to be one of the first guests to stay at the William Vale Hotel in Williamsburg. The 21 story property by Aldo Lamberis,  has 183 rooms, 25 of which are suites. All 183 rooms however come equipped with a balcony, rare for New York City!

The shiny marble lobby and floor to ceiling windows was a photographers dream--ton's of natural light to accent the hotel's sleek interior design.

A New Take on New York City

by gregory davalos


I'm no stranger to the big apple (18 trips and counting) the city never sleeps, the weather is usually terrible and the people are never happy--the energy however, is magnetic. 

I recently got the opportunity to visit New York with NYC GO and see the city like never before. Up until now, my trips to New York have always been work related. Waking up to a jam packed schedule, taxis from meeting to meeting, dinner, sleep, repeat. This was the first time I was able to see the city for what it really is--a beautiful and chaotic cluster of boroughs, each with their own unique personality and aesthetic. I also came to find that New Yorkers are a lot more kind than their reputation suggests. 

Rather than a traditional stay in Manhattan, I got to call Brooklyn home. It was my first time ever venturing that far east and it's safe to say it was love at first sight. A majority of my time was spent in Williamsburg, which reminded me a lot of Silver Lake here in Los Angeles. The community is mostly made up of young creatives that appreciate a health conscious lifestyle almost as much as Angelenos do! The phenomenon known as the "Brooklyn Bubble" is REAL. I didn't board the L train for Manhattan unless absolutely necessary, Brooklyn really has everything you need.

In addition to exploring all Williamsburg has to offer, I also got the opportunity to visit Coney Island, Governors Island and the Metropolitan Museum of Art before it opened to the public! 

As a native (and proud) Angeleno, New York definetley earned a place in my heart after this trip.

Yucatán Peninsula

by gregory davalos


A few weeks ago, I traveled back to Mexico to explore the Yucatán Peninsula with Onia.  For whatever reason, fate would have it that I was to visit Mexico twice in the same month with Jenny Ong. 

When we touched down at the airport we were greeted by an intense tropical storm that laid the foundation for a week-long humid oasis. After a brisk drive, we entered the gates of The Nizuc Resort & Spa and I quickly understood why Onia chose the property. 

Much like their swimwear, Nizuc boasted a clean and modern silhouette that was elevated and luxe--but not pretentious. The secluded property was a tranquil mixture of beach and jungle. Over the course of the trip we sailed through the Peninsula and ate copious amounts Octopus ceviche.
